Lot Description
An early 19th century oak and mahogany cased 30-hour painted dial longcase clock, William Parker, Repton, circa 1820, the 12-inch square Arabic dial with floral decoration over calendar crescent and maker's signature, within floral spandrels, bell-striking chain movement, the case with stepped, moulded cornice and inlaid frieze over fluted columns, crossbanded long door between fluted quadrant columns and crossbanded panelled base, 79.5" (202.5cm) high.

Condition Report
Some flanking and repainting to dial. Movement appears ok, not warranted. Case- grain crack to one side panel of hood. Two more to lower halves of trunk sides, two more to side of base and one to front.
